Hi, I have a problem
I am building a hometheatre pc. I am trying to figure out what out put to use and what TV to use. I have not bought my TV yet but I do have the computer set up. it has a 9600xt with svideo and dvi output. Which will give me the best picture. do dvi to hdmi converters work well? You get a lot better picture from the DVI than S-Video.
Those DVI-to-HDMI adapters work good but look for one which has an audio input too as graphics cards (exept from Radeon HD 2400/2600 series) can't supply audio like the HDMI would need.
